AI阅读助手ChatDOC:基于 AI 与文档对话、重新定义阅读方式的AI文献阅读和文档处理工具
让 AI 真正成为你的生产力超级助手
AI 时代降临,我们需要积极拥抱 AI 工具
在过去的 2 个多月里,以 ChatGPT 为代表的 AI 风靡全球。随着 GPT 模型的不断优化,ChatGPT 在多个领域表现出了堪比专家的水平。目前,已有不少专家将 ChatGPT 为代表 AI 浪潮,视为新一次工业革命的开始。面对 ChatGPT, 有人欣喜若狂,有人焦虑难安。无论我们抱有何种态度,AI 时代已经降临。 AI 是否可替代人类,或许过于遥远。善用 AI 工具的人,效率将提升十倍百倍,替代不使用或者不擅长 AI 工具的人。
超越 ChatGPT,让 AI 处理我们的专属数据
以 ChatGPT 为例,OpenAI 官方提供了 40 多种使用场景。每一天人们都在尝试探索 AI 使用的可能性和边界。与此同时,ChatGPT 并非全知全能。ChatGPT 背后的 3.0 为例,其训练数据截止于 2021 年。如果训练模型不更新的话,那么,ChatGPT 不具备创造新知识的能力。此外,对于不熟悉的领域,ChatGPT 可能会基于大规模语言模型的特点,进行看似逻辑无暇的、一本正经的胡说八道。
那么,如何解决这个问题?
以微软为代表的 New Bing 提供了解决思路,将搜索引擎和 AI 模型的优点进行融合,针对用户的提问,提供更为精准的答案,并提供与答案相关的引文信息。 这种解决方案,在很大程度上便是 New Bing 将新的数据实时投喂给 GPT, 再生成用户所需要的结果。
如果,我们所要处理的数据,搜索引擎无法抓取,或者难以处理的时候,New Bing 的结果便大打折扣。 换个思路,如果作为用户的我们,使用自己的知识库,主动将自己的专属数据投喂至 AI,那么,AI 将成为提升我们生产力的超级助手。基于这个思路的产品,便是 ChatDOC.
什么是 ChatDOC?
ChatDOC 是一款基于 ChatGPT,允许 ChatGPT 与用户所指定的文档进行对话,处理用户的专属数据的 AI 阅读辅助工具。
ChatDOC 的特点
操作简单:一键上传,快速上手
一键上传文档,快速让 AI 处理文档数据。通过与 AI 助手对话式学习,深入挖掘文本结构和内容。
文本智能分析:文本、表格数据处理均准确高效
- 多场景阅读辅助。基于 GPT 的强大能力,对于文献内容的总结、摘要、翻译、知识点查询等需求,均可在 AI 辅助下快速完成。
- 支持追问功能。允许用户像 Twitter Thread 那样,针对某一特定问答,以新的子窗口打开持续进行多轮问答。
- 强大的文本解析能力。在 ChatDOC 中,除了拥有 GPT 原本强悍的文本分析能力,此外基于开发团队在内容识别领域丰富的技术积累,使得 ChatDOC 对于表格等数据内容的处理,依然准确高效。
内容回溯功能:基于问答结果快速查看原文
不同于 ChatGPT 的处于黑箱之中、无法追溯来源的答案,ChatDOC 的特点在于,AI 所生成的结果均是基于用户所提供的专有数据,有据可循。 在每个回答下方, AI 提供了与这个答案相关的引文页面。点击便可以直接跳转至该页面的具体位置,查看原文的具体表述。
保障用户数据安全:加密存储、数据自主
所有上传的数据,均以加密形式存储至云端。用户对自己的数据据拥有完全的所有权,随时可下载和删除任何文件。
ChaDOC 的使用
ChatDOC 的使用方式十分简单。
- 用户登录之后,一键上传你需要处理的论文、书籍或者其他文件。
- ChatDOC 很快基于 GPT对文档内容进行智能分析;
- 随后,用户便可以以聊天的形式,针对上传文档的内容展开对话交流。
上传文件
如下图,点击或者拖拽上传本地文件。随后,在对文献进行智能解析后,系统会自动根据文献生成示例问题。
提问方式
- 针对全文提问:直接在对话框中输入问题。或者,点击默认的几个示例问题,开始 AI 辅助阅读之旅。
- 针对特定内容提问。选中内容,点击靶心标志,确认选择。随后,再进行提问。
适用场景
通过基于 AI 辅助的文档阅读,ChatDOC 能够帮助用户快速分析文档、理解内容、激发灵感和扩展视野,适合办公人士、教育用户群体、以及各类对于知识管理、信息管理感兴趣的群体。
在本文中的示范文档,并非我所熟悉的领域。借助 AI 辅助,我可以快速获取文章摘要、深挖特定观点和数据、翻译文本、总结内容……帮助我快速了解一个我完全不熟悉领域的知识和信息。
对于学术论文而言,常见的结构是:引言、文献回顾、理论框架、创新点、研究方法、研究过程、主要观点和结论、进一步研究方向。
如果英语阅读不够熟练,完成对于上述结构的阅读,通常需要15-30 分钟。如今,通过ChatDOC 的 AI 辅助,我可以在 1 分钟内,快速完成一篇文章的阅读。
提示词:请依次告诉我这篇文章的引言、文献回顾、理论框架、创新点、研究方法、研究过程、主要观点和结论、进一步研究方向。
回答效果如下:
为了将来更好地整理阅读笔记,我决定细化提问。
在各类笔记形式中,大纲列表可以方便用户快速鸟瞰笔记结构,查看笔记细节。此外,大纲列表可以快速一键切换为思维导图。基于上述设想。我的新的提问如下:
注释:提问后半部分的格式说明,是为了防止 AI 有时候没有严格按照格式生成内容。
生成结果如图:
随后,我将上述内容复制粘贴至我正在使用的笔记软件 FlowUs 页面,放在这篇文章标题 SelfDoc 的节点之下。点击内容块,将其转换为思维导图。
内容块·转换
将大纲列表一键转化为思维导图效果如下:
当然了,如果不需要将内容细分为二级子节点内容进行拆分也可以。如图:
如果你愿意,也可以直接让 AI 以表格形式输出结果。
上面主要是基于全文的提问。ChatDOC 还允许用户针对文档中的具体内容与 AI 互动。比如,让 AI 解读表格、解释公式、阐释文中的概念。
如下图,可以看到,ChaDOC 对于表格的选取和解析效果非常好。
下图为针对公式和特定概念的提问结果。
需要注意的是,ChatDOC 还支持追问功能,能满足用户对于知识的深度挖掘。
点击每个回答中右下角、两个折叠的对话框按钮,便可以进入 Thread 窗口。用户可以在其中,针对某个主题进行多轮、深入问答。
如图,针对已有的回答,我先追问了“什么是自监督学习框架”,随后在新的答案中,又追问了“跨模态学习又是指什么?”
ChatDOC 的定价机制
目前支持注册一个免费的 ChatDOC 帐户。其中,免费版本,可以在 24 小时内上传最多 5 个文件,每个文件不超过 200 页。此外,免费版本还可以在同一个 24 小时内提出多达 300 个问题。
后续,ChatDOC 应该会增加付费功能,提供一些增值服务。
ChatDOC 的未来发展
Chatdoc 虽然目前对于阅读辅助很有帮助,但是依然有不少优化空间。下面是 ChatDOC 官方的产品规划路线图。
- 支持基于多个文件的聊天对话查询。
- 支持更多的文件类型,比如扫描文件或者图片。
- 优化引文结果。
以上便是 ChatDOC 的一些使用体验。使用案例中,只是展示了ChatDOC 的部分功能。更多地 AI 使用技巧,还需要用户根据自己需求进行探索。
效率工具箱:阅读、笔记、写作 AI
AI 阅读辅助工具:ChatDOC
知识管理和在线协作工具:FlowUs 息流
特点
FlowUs AI
- 自定义问答;
- 自定义创作;
- 预设问答与创作:头脑风暴、列出执行步骤、罗列大纲、分析优缺点、内容解释、日常小记、故事创作、写文章、翻译、总结
FlowUs AI :公测全面开启,智能化解决工作、学习、生活中的各项任务2 赞同 · 1 评论文章
使用教程
更多关于 FlowUs 使用技巧的介绍
书签管理: Wetab 新标签页
Wetab 是一款基于浏览器的新标签页产品,主张辅助用户打造一个兼具效率与美观的主页。
产品特色与功能
移动端使用教程
移动端·综合教程图文版
AI阅读助手ChatDOC:基于 AI 与文档对话、重新定义阅读方式的AI文献阅读和文档处理工具的更多相关文章
- 解决SharePoint文档库文件在搜索结果页面显示的标题和文档的标题不一致问题(search result)
问题表现: SharePoint 2013 爬网后,搜索一个文档,虽然搜到了,但是显示有点问题,如图: 原因分析: 造成该问题的原因是,该文档除了本身有一个名称外,在文档metadata的title属 ...
- 华为nova3发布,将支持华为AI旅行助手
华为nova3于7月18日18:00在深圳大运中心体育馆举行华为nova 3的发布会,从本次华为nova3选择的代言人-易烊千玺,不难看出新机依然延续nova系列的年轻属性,主打 “高颜值 爱自 ...
- 深度 | AI芯片之智能边缘计算的崛起——实时语言翻译、图像识别、AI视频监控、无人车这些都需要终端具有较强的计算能力,从而AI芯片发展起来是必然,同时5G网络也是必然
from:https://36kr.com/p/5103044.html 到2020年,大多数先进的ML袖珍电脑(你仍称之为手机)将有能力执行一整套任务.个人助理将变的更加智能,它是打造这种功能的切入 ...
- 基于slate构建文档编辑器
基于slate构建文档编辑器 slate.js是一个完全可定制的框架,用于构建富文本编辑器,在这里我们使用slate.js构建专注于文档编辑的富文本编辑器. 描述 Github | Editor DE ...
- 基于word2vec的文档向量模型的应用
基于word2vec的文档向量模型的应用 word2vec的原理以及训练过程具体细节就不介绍了,推荐两篇文档:<word2vec parameter learning explained> ...
- ESA2GJK1DH1K升级篇: STM32远程乒乓升级,基于(Wi-Fi模块AT指令TCP透传方式),MQTT通信控制升级
实现功能概要 前面的版本都是,定时访问云端的程序版本,如果版本不一致,然后下载最新的升级文件,实现升级. 这一节,在用户程序里面加入MQTT通信,执行用户程序的时候,通过接收MQTT的升级命令实现升级 ...
- SpringBoot接口 - 如何生成接口文档之非侵入方式(通过注释生成)Smart-Doc?
通过Swagger系列可以快速生成API文档,但是这种API文档生成是需要在接口上添加注解等,这表明这是一种侵入式方式: 那么有没有非侵入式方式呢, 比如通过注释生成文档? 本文主要介绍非侵入式的方式 ...
- 文献阅读笔记——group sparsity and geometry constrained dictionary
周五实验室有同学报告了ICCV2013的一篇论文group sparsity and geometry constrained dictionary learning for action recog ...
- 移动基于Percona XTRADB Cluster的大数据解决方式
移动基于Percona XTRADB Cluster的大数据解决方式 一.移动的去IOE之旅 近期由于"棱镜门"事件的曝光.引起了国家对信息安全问题的注 ...
- ESA2GJK1DH1K升级篇: 移植远程更新程序到STM32F103RET6型号的单片机,基于(GPRS模块AT指令TCP透传方式)
前言 上节实现远程更新是更新的STM32F103C8T6的单片机 GPRS网络(Air202/SIM800)升级STM32: 测试STM32远程乒乓升级,基于(GPRS模块AT指令TCP透传方式),定 ...
随机推荐
- java datetime数据类型去掉时分秒
在Java中,如果我们想要表示一个日期而不包括时间(时分秒),我们通常会使用java.time包中的LocalDate类.LocalDate是一个不可变的日期对象,它只包含年.月.日三个字段. 1. ...
- 深入理解Android View(1)
做android其实也有一段时间了,我们每个人都会碰到一些这样或那样的问题,碰到问题了就拼命百度,可是发现,我们解决问题的能力并没有提升很多,所以我才有想总结一下我项目中所用过的相关知识,并了解一下A ...
- QuartzNet暂停恢复会执行多次的问题解决
' var config = new System.Collections.Specialized.NameValueCollection { { "quartz.jobStore.misf ...
- P9358 题解
不难发现,最开始有 \(n\) 条链,并且由于每个点最多有一个桥,所以我们的交换操作实际上等价于将相邻的两条链断开,然后将它们后半部分交换.并且每个点在路径中的相对位置不变. 于是考虑维护这些链. 有 ...
- ComfyUI进阶篇:ComfyUI核心节点(一)
ComfyUI进阶篇:ComfyUI核心节点(一) 前言: 学习ComfyUI是一场持久战.当你掌握了ComfyUI的安装和运行之后,会发现大量五花八门的节点.面对各种各样的工作流和复杂的节点种类,可 ...
- Linux开机启动自定义脚本
方式一:chkconfig命令 首先编写好自启的脚本 /etc/init.d/test.sh #!/bin/sh # chkconfig: 2345 10 90 # 创建个文件 touch /opt/ ...
- Spring(注解方式)简单入门
环境准备 maven jdk Spring Eclipse 项目创建 pom.xml <project xmlns="http://maven.apache.org/POM/4.0.0 ...
- Vue3 之 computed 计算属性的使用与源码分析详细注释
目录 计算属性的基本用法 计算属性的源码 shared 工具方法抽离 计算属性的基本用法 computed 一般有两种常见的用法: 一:传入一个对象,内部有 set 和 get 方法,属于Comput ...
- [oeasy]python0048_注释_comment_设置默认编码格式
注释Comment 回忆上次内容 使用了版本控制 git 制作备份 进行回滚 尝试了 嵌套的控制结构 层层 控制 不过 除非 到不得以 尽量不要 太多层次的嵌套 这样 从顶到底 含义 明确 ...
- [oeasy]python0010 - python虚拟机解释执行py文件的原理
解释运行程序 回忆上次内容 我们这次设置了断点 设置断点的目的是更快地调试 调试的目的是去除bug 别害怕bug 一步步地总能找到bug 这就是程序员基本功 调试deb ...